English term or phrase: Skimming and scanning
It is often a good idea to skim through the whole text to get a general idea of the story or the main points. You might be asked to give an overall impression of something you hear or read. In this case you don't need to understand every word ....

Skimming is to read the text for general ideas and to get the gist, while scanning is to read slowly to know the exact meaning and the details of the text.
